States, counties and metro areas fall into the red zone if during the last week they reported new cases above 100 per 100,000 residents or a positivity rate of over 10%, according to the previously unpublicized July 14 document, obtained and first reported on by the Center for Public Integrity, a nonprofit newsroom based in Washington, D.C. A document prepared for the White House Coronavirus Task Force shows both Texas and the Dallas-Fort Worth area are in the red zone and recommends additional restrictions to curb the surge in coronavirus cases, according to a Center for Public Integrity report.
